Biden-Harris Administration Investing in Utah Waterfowl

Government and Politics

May 10, 2024


Salt Lake City - On May 10th, the Utah Democratic Party celebrates the Biden Administration's $3,000,000 grant to Ducks Unlimited for the enhancement of 7,439 acres of aquatic bed wetlands in the Great Salt Lake and lower Bear River ecosystems. The grant comes with a proposed $6,113,637 match from partners including the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ints and the Utah Department of Natural Resources.
